Transaction 7fc5bb37a21376a41033a585d9921923fd21d9429311c721a1cc4af431489a73

4 Input
2 Outputs
  • 7fc5bb37a21376a41033a585d9921923fd21d9429311c721a1cc4af431489a73:0
  • value  32899250
    address  12G2DYY8BpZnwFTR5PVG29NDqNnD66fSUB
  • 7fc5bb37a21376a41033a585d9921923fd21d9429311c721a1cc4af431489a73:1
  • value  6892163
    address  1D7q7ejP2j5N4nkGDpuR2cLBwd3dpZf1yr